Former 'Romans' Join Forces


News provided by Pressat Wire on Monday 27th Apr 2015



Ahead of imminent expansion plans, Director of Capital & Coastal, Michael Riley, a former Head of Operations for Romans in the Thames Valley, has welcomed Iain White, formerly Managing Director of Romans South, as a non-executive director to his company.

The pair worked together at Romans from 1993-2007 before Mr Riley went on to be Head of Residential Sales for Savills. In 2011, after spending 21 years with Romans, Iain White moved to Countrywide as MD of their Thames subsidiary with coverage in London and the M3/M4 corridor. Meanwhile, Michael Riley had left Savills to set up on his own, forming Capital & Coastal, a hybrid estate agency specialising in the sale and let of property with water frontage, sea views and coastal locations along the South coast.

Iain White will be supporting Capital & Coastal with updating their operational systems, future acquisitions and expansion of existing business model, as well as providing a valuable counsel to Michael Riley.
